It’s raining biopics in Bollywood. Just yesterday, we reported that cricketer MS Dhoni was set to turn a producer with the biopic of legendary Hockey Player Dhyan Chand. Directed by National Award winning filmmaker Rohit Vaid, it is likely to cast Varun Dhawan.

The latest one to join the wagon is Sonu Sood, who has bought the rights of biopic on Badminton player PV Sindhu. Sindhu became the first ever female Badminton player of India to win a silver medal, at Olympics 2016.

With this, quite naturally, speculations pertaining to who might play Sindhu’s character have started doing rounds. In one of her older interviews, Sindhu had expressed her desire to act in her own biopic. However, if gossip mongers are to be believed, then Deepika Padukone is going to be considered for the same. However, nothing is confirmed yet. A source close to Deepika told Mid-Day, “It is natural to assume that she will be approached to play the part because she is familiar with the sport. Having said that, Deepika is fully invested in ‘Padmavati’ now. If the part is offered to her and she likes the script and director, and has the time for it, she will surely give her nod. Sonu and she know each other from the time they worked in ‘Happy New Year’ (2014), so it won’t be surprise.”

Deepika, who happens to be the daughter of Badminton player Prakash Padukone, was very much into the same sport until showbiz happened to her. At one point in her life, she in fact wanted to become a professional Badminton player only.

Sonu, although, says he has only bought the rights and nothing else has been decided yet.
